The 1064 nm Nd:YAG laser has a long wavelength and reaches deep. In Korea it is used for pigment, vessels and hair removal; this page covers only the trials in keratosis pilaris.
Keratosis pilaris is the common, stubborn roughness on the outer arms and thighs — keratin plugging follicular openings with redness around them. Topical keratolytics such as urea and salicylic acid are first line, but it generally returns when you stop.
What makes this stand out on this site is the control group. Trials of device treatments usually compare against an untreated area; the trial below used the same device held the same way with the light switched off. It was designed to subtract what merely applying the device does.
What is established
Skin roughness fell below the sham-irradiated area
This is a 2020 trial at Chulalongkorn University, Thailand. 23 people with untreated keratosis pilaris on the upper outer arms took part.
The design is tight. One arm was divided into an upper and a lower part, and one part was randomised to the 1064 nm Nd:YAG laser while the other received sham irradiation. Four treatments at four-week intervals, with Antera3D measurements of roughness, erythema and pigmentation four weeks after the last session.
Results:
- Roughness measured by Antera3D fell significantly below the control part (P < .001).
- On the participants' Global Improvement Score, roughness, erythema, pigmentation and overall appearance all improved significantly (all P < .001).
- Satisfaction scores were significantly better for the treated parts (P < .001).
- No adverse events — burning, bullae, erosion, post-inflammatory pigment change or scarring — occurred in any subject throughout.
One thing has to be flagged. The paper's title says 'randomized, double-blind, sham-irradiation-controlled', while the methods say 'randomized, single-blind'. Those are not the same claim. The abstract does not settle which is correct, so we read it the weaker way (single-blind).
This matters because of the endpoints. Instrument-measured roughness is less swayed by who knew what, but the participants' own global improvement and satisfaction scores can tilt if they knew which part was treated.
And there were 23 people. A single small trial.

It tied with 20% TCA
This is a 2022 trial at Cairo University, Egypt. 20 people had 20% trichloroacetic acid (TCA) compared against the long-pulsed 1064 nm Nd:YAG laser, assessed clinically and by dermoscopic score.
Investigator Global Assessment:
- Laser-treated area: moderate improvement in 2 (10%), marked in 10 (50%), excellent in 8 (40%)
- TCA-treated area: marked in 9 (45%), excellent in 11 (55%)
Dermoscopic scores fell significantly with both, and neither the global assessment nor the reduction in dermoscopic score differed between the two methods.
Before reading this as 'the laser is as good as TCA', see two things.
First, there were 20 people. Comparing two active treatments in 20 people and finding no difference may mean there is none, or that there was no power to find one.
Second, numerically TCA was slightly ahead — excellent improvement in 55% against 40%.
The practical difference lies elsewhere, though. 20% TCA is far cheaper and available anywhere. If there is a reason to choose the laser it is more likely about downtime or risk by skin type — and this trial did not make that comparison.

Known risks
- The 2020 trial reported no burns, bullae, erosion, post-inflammatory pigment change or scarring at all. But that was 23 people, on arms only.
- The general risks of a 1064 nm laser apply: transient erythema, swelling and pain. A rubber-band snap sensation during treatment is common.
- The darker the skin, the higher the risk of pigment change. The trials above were run in Thailand and Egypt.
- Keratosis pilaris generally returns when treatment stops. Neither trial looked beyond the end of treatment.
- Say in advance if you take anything that causes photosensitivity.
What is not established
- We found no trial measuring how long it lasts. The longest look was four weeks after the final session.
- We found no randomised comparison against topical keratolytics. Whether to choose this over urea or salicylic acid cannot be answered here.
- How many sessions is right is unsettled. The trial above used four.
- Device settings are not given in detail in the abstracts. Even at 1064 nm, pulse width and fluence make it a different treatment.
- Both trials enrolled around 20 people.
